The resulting files are then distributed via HTTP.(c) pkg_version – List the installed version of the package is older than the current version.

All of the above utilities work together to keeping Free BSD up to date :)On Free BSD 6.0 , portsnap is contained in the Free BSD base (core) system.

If a port fails to "make" during update it is marked as ignored.

Portmanager will continue updating any ports not marked as "ignored" so long as they are not dependent on the ignored port. However, I’ve tons of apps installed under Free BSD. Free BSD comes with various tools to to install and update software packages.The portmaster command line tool is used to install and update software packages. Most of the actions listed in this FAQ are written with the assumption that they will be executed by the root user running the csh or bash shell. Only run this command to initialize your portsnap-maintained ports tree for the first time: Open /usr/ports/UPDATING file using a text editor and read information regarding your applications. The freebsd-update tool is used to fetch, install, and rollback binary updates to the Free BSD base system. If you need to upgrade all installed ports with logging, enter: Latest version includes a tool called freebsd-update (thanks to Bok for pointing out this tool).

